#fde4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fde4ae is composed of 99.2% red, 89.4%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.9%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 41 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 83.7%. #fde4ae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fbc95d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#fde4ae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fde4ae has RGB values of R:253, G:228,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.31,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16639150.

Hex triplet fde4ae #fde4ae
RGB Decimal 253, 228, 174 rgb(253,228,174)
RGB Percent 99.2, 89.4, 68.2 rgb(99.2%,89.4%,68.2%)
CMYK 0, 10, 31, 1
HSL 41°, 95.2, 83.7 hsl(41,95.2%,83.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 41°, 31.2, 99.2
Web Safe ffcc99 #ffcc99
CIE-LAB 91.427, 0.811, 29.517
XYZ 75.891, 79.427, 51.375
xyY 0.367, 0.384, 79.427
CIE-LCH 91.427, 29.528, 88.425
CIE-LUV 91.427, 18.687, 41.089
Hunter-Lab 89.122, -3.964, 28.207
Binary 11111101, 11100100, 10101110

Shades and Tints of #fde4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.
